About this ebook
Speculative poetry exploring the development of emotion and the sense of self in robots. Description of the intersection between human and machine in modern free verse. Self-image, political will, the sense of community, the sense of loneliness. Individually, poems have appeared in “Analog”, “Asimov’s”, “Rattle”, “The Adirondack Review”, and other literary and genre magazines.
Ken Poyner
Ken Poyner has published more than 200 stories and 1200 poems in more than 200 journals and magazines, both print and web based. His books include "Cordwood" (poetry), 1985; "Sciences, Social" (poetry), 1995; "Constant Animals" (fictions), 2013; "The Book of Robot"; (poetry), 2016; "Victims of a Failed Civics"; (poetry), 2016; "Avenging Cartography"; (fictions), 2017; "The Revenge of the House Hurlers" (fictions), 2018; and more, with his latest being speculative poetry in "Lessons From Lingering Houses", 2022. He has taught creative writing on a Poets in the Schools Virginia teaching fellowship; and given readings, or taught seminars, at Bucknel University, George Washington University, the Bethesda Writers Center, and elsewhere. He has been nominated for multiple Pushcart prizes, multiple Rhysling and Dwarf Stars awards, the Sidewise award, and several Best of the Net awards. His work appears in a number of contemporary anthologies. He is known for his surreal and Irreal topics and methods.

THE BOOK OF ROBOT
This is the overview of layers:
How processor stacks upon processor;
How chips feed into arrays;
How array upon array slips into core.
Here is the schematic of how cache
Is locked, cornered with a single gate.
This is the drawing
Of one particular processor’s latches,
The termination of pathways,
The ascendancy of execution registers.
Here
Is a gleeful list of processor types,
Each with a different purpose,
From simplest appliance
To central master controller.
These are the cunning design diagrams
For power monitoring, and secondary recovery.
Here are the options for memory maps:
Memory available to core;
Memory for semi-autonomous systems;
Memory for personalization.
There are the interrupt filaments,
Cold in their warming ways.
Here is how and where expansion slots can add
Their heft, fit contentedly in with everything else.
For all factory recommended programs,
There is even a list of DLL branch points
And a series of processor affinities.
Later, there are chassis interconnects,
The tolerances for locomotion,
The width of registers given over to balance.
Options and upgrades are included,
With what benefit must go when another,
Curiously specific, is added.
Accessing each scintillating diagram is like stretching
A soul between two equal oblivions.
I page through the whole of it as a persistent
Background routine, see in myself
All the skill and imagination of the engineers
I may never meet, but who I can know through this manifest.
